How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Lexington Maria?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Lexington Maria Studio Apartments | $2,485 | $972 | $3,811 |
| Lexington Maria 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,225 | $1,036 | $7,299 |
| Lexington Maria 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,152 | $1,233 | $10,000+ |
| Lexington Maria 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,920 | $1,460 | $10,000+ |
| Lexington Maria 4 Bedroom Apartments | $8,682 | $4,516 | $10,000+ |
